Is a milling machine the same as a router?
The main difference between a mill and a router is the axis motion. A router has a stationary workpiece and a spindle that moves in X, Y, and Z. While on a mill, the part moves in X and Y, and the spindle moves in Z.Is CNC the same as milling?

What is a CNC router vs mill?
A CNC mill is the better choice for industrial-grade materials since a router doesn’t have the same amount of power. A router cuts much faster than a milling machine, but it has less torque, using rotational speed to drive the force to the tool. The RPM of a CNC router is much faster than the speed of a mill.
What is wood router machine?
The router is a power tool with a flat base and a rotating blade extending past the base. The spindle may be driven by an electric motor or by a pneumatic motor. It routs (hollows out) an area in hard material, such as wood or plastic. Routers are used most often in woodworking, especially cabinetry.

How much is a CNC router?
CNC Router Average Costs The most basic of three-axis models sell for anywhere from $5,000 to $10,000. Mid-range machines used for panel processing and signage are likely to cost anywhere from $25,000 to $50,000. High-end machines often cost $50,000 to $150,000.

Can you use a router as a biscuit joiner?
If you want to make biscuit joints, you don’t have to buy a biscuit joiner. In most cases, a router equipped with a 5/32-in. slot bit can cut perfect slots to fit the biscuits. Mark the biscuit positions on both adjoining boards as you would with a biscuit joiner.
